Background dependent cutoff for Wilson actions

High Energy Physics - Theory 2024-08-08 v1

Abstract

We study the application of the background field method in the framework of the exact renormalization group (ERG). By considering the case of a scalar field theory, we provide a detailed discussion of the properties satisfied by a background dependent Wilson action. We show how the Ward identity associated with background field shifts for the Wilson action is related to that for the 1PI Wilson action, or effective average action. Moreover, we discuss the ERG equations in the dimensionless framework and emphasize the role of the Ward identity in this setting. We give two examples: the Gaussian fixed point for the real scalar theory and the large NN limit of the linear sigma model.
